Purpose Statement

The job of CE Childcare Associate I is to provide support to the instructional program within the assigned classroom. Responsibilities include implementing programs for the personal and emotional growth of referred students; assisting in monitoring behaviors; and communicating observations to teachers, parents, and administrators. This job reports to CE Childcare Associate V.

Essential Functions
  • Administer first aid for ill, medically fragile, or injured children.
  • Assist students with personal care needs such as diapering, toilet training, feeding, etc.
  • Work with individual or small groups on age‑appropriate activities (games, art, music, science, language, nutrition, playground, hand washing, etc.) to reinforce learning concepts.
  • Communicate with internal staff to convey and receive required information.
  • Complete a minimum of 18 hours of approved training annually to meet health regulations.
  • Distribute instructional and play materials.
  • Establish positive relationships to build student confidence and self‑esteem.
  • Implement instructional programs and lesson plans under supervision.
  • Maintain classroom equipment, work area, files, and records ensuring availability, safety, and compliance.
  • Maintain acceptable behavior standards consistent with district policy.
  • Monitor students in various settings (snack time, games, playground, quiet time, field trips, classroom, homework time, etc.) to ensure safety and positivity.
  • Organize quiet or active, age‑appropriate indoor/outdoor activities.
  • Prepare nutritional snacks, lunches, bottles according to guidelines.
  • Provide ongoing feedback to supervisor, teacher, and parents.
  • Transfer children directly from/to parents or designee for safety and district requirements.
